Chickamauga Slim Posted June 16, 2020 Share Posted June 16, 2020 14 hours ago, Goody, SASS #26190 said: Bullets by Scarlett https://bulletsbyscarlett.com/shop/ols/categories/cowboy-cartridges-low-velocity-specifically-for-cowboy-shooter Most off the shelf factory cowboy loads are really too hot for this game. Get in touch with Scarlett Darlin' and get ammo made by a cowboy shooter for cowboy shooting. She has quality products and is a huge supporter of annual matches across the country. And when you are ready to reload your own (it will be sooner rather than later) she has as good a bullet as money can buy. Scarlett is a great resource for ammo, bullets, & custom fitted ear plugs.
